If you’re a survivor, it’s important to take one day at a time. Let 101Tips for Survivors of Sexual Abuse be your companion in healing andyou’ll be reminded of the strength and wisdom that’s already inside you.This book will help you celebrate the good days and develop solid copingstrategies for the bad times. Most importantly, this book will remindthat you’re not alone and it was never your fault.Acclaim for 101 Tips For Survivors of Sexual Abuse: A Pocket Book of Wisdom'You can never have too much support as a survivor. Recovering From AbuseAbout the authorAmy Barth’s background is in social work and she founded the Safe Girls Strong Girls in 2005. SGSG is a nonprofit committed to breaking the silence of Childhood Sexual Abuse (CSA) and giving girls their voices back. One SGSG project is Camp CADI, a one-of-a kind camp where girls can heal and just be girls again.
